Armenian Deputy Justice Minister and CoE Deputy Secreatry General Discuss Judiciary Reforms
Armenian Deputy Justice Minister Vigen Kocharyan today, in Yerevan, discussed judicial reform issues with Council of Europe Deputy Secretary General Gabriella Battaini-Dragoni and her delegation.
According to an Armenian government press release, Gabriella Battaini-Dragoni said that the Council of Europe would work with Armenia to reform the country’s judiciary and that it has already allocated sizeable financial assistance to do so.
Kocharyan said the Armenian government is determined to depend on the Council of Europe for standards and experience during the reform process.
